A cold water hydropneumatic tank is mounted at the roof level mechanical room floor with a system connection to the cold water supply piping. An isolation valve is installed on the cold water line above the tank, and a hose end drain valve is connected near the tank base. A Watts 174A water pressure relief valve ties into the system with a drain line. A charging valve is located at the top of the tank for pressurization per schedule.
FLOOR NOTES: 1. SEE PLANS OR RISER FOR PIPE SIZES. 2. AIR IN TANK MUST BE CHARGED TO 2 PSI LESS THAN WATER PRESSURE IN TANK.
